On the iPhone, I set up my Google Account to use Exchange, as seen in the google help doc about it:
http://www.google.com/support/mobile/bin/answer.py?answer=138740&topic=14252
If you have multiple calendars, you may need to enable the other ones by going to m.google.com on your phone in Safari and then clicking the Sync button, then it will have you log in with your gmail account.  Once you are logged in, you can choose your iPhone and pick which calendars to sync.
On iCal on the Mac, you can set up your calendars using CalDav by going into the Preferences--> Accounts, then click the + icon at the bottom and choose Gmail from the pull down list, then enter your account info.
To show any additional calendars on there, you would want to choose your acount in the preferences, and choose Delegates and enable whatever other calendars you need.
If you don't like the CalDav syncing on iCal (on the mac), you can also look at SpanningSync.  It does a very good job of syncing your google calendars and contacts with your mac.
The exchange setup on the iPhone and iPad works perfectly for me though, so I didn't need any special software to do it, just the right setup.
One tip, let the calendar/contacts FINISH syncing before you try to add or make changes.. you'll get errors and stuff if you aren't patient with it.  When I first open iCal, I sometimes have to wait a little bit before the spinning icon stops next to the calendar before it's safe to enter in new appointments. I will occasionally leave iCal up all day if I know I'll need to add and change a lot of appointments.

  • Bookmarks toolbar Firefox 10.0.2/OSX 10.6.8 - gone. View Toolbars Bookmarks Toolbar - checked. Dragging URL's to bookmarks toolbar area no longer works. Gray area appears/disappears when checked/unchecked but will not show any or accept new bookmarks.

    My bookmarks toolbar in Firefox 10.0.2 Mac OSX 10.6.8 suddenly disappeared. View>Toolbars>Bookmarks Toolbar is checked. Dragging URL's to the bookmarks toolbar area no longer works. The gray area appears and disappears when checking/unchecking under View/Toolbars menu, but will not show any or accept addition of bookmarks.

    Make sure that toolbars like the "Navigation Toolbar" and the "Bookmarks Toolbar" are visible: "View > Toolbars"
    *Open the Customize window via "View > Toolbars > Customize"
    *Check that the "Bookmarks Toolbar items" is on the Bookmarks Toolbar
    *If the "Bookmarks Toolbar items" is not on the Bookmarks Toolbar then drag it back from the toolbar palette in the customize window to the Bookmarks Toolbar
    *If missing items are in the toolbar palette then drag them back from the Customize window on the toolbar
    *If you do not see an item on a toolbar and in the toolbar palette then click the "Restore Default Set" button to restore the default toolbar set up

    To change your iCloud ID you have to delete the account, then sign in with the alternate ID.  Before doing this, if you want to keep your data and move it to the new account, go to Settings>iCloud and turn each of your synced data to Off, and when prompted choose to keep the data on your iPhone.  When everything is turned off, scroll to the bottom and tap Delete Account, the sign back in with your other account ID and turn syncing back on; when prompted, choose merge.
    If all your data is already in your other account then you don't need to do this.  Just delete the account from your phone, selected not to keep the data, then sign into the new account, turn on data syncing and if prompted, choose merge.

  • Alert boxes when I use ebay

    Hi people,
    I'm suddenly getting Safari ‘alerts’ when I view my summary page on ebay.
    When I click on my ebay page in top sites (or refresh my summary page when I’m already on ebay, or return to the summary page from another ebay page) I get the summary page but am also getting a pop up little (4 inches x 1.5 inches approx) Safari alert box with the Safari symbol on the left, with http://my.ebay.co.uk in bold type and the number 3 in plain type under that and the blue OK button to click on on the right.
    I click on it and the alert disappears to be replaced by an identical box. I click on the OK button on that one and it disappears completely and I can use safari properly.
    Can anyone tell me what’s going on? I tried resetting Safari but it’s still happening. It’s a bit irritating to have to get rid of the two alerts every time I want to view that page.
    Thanks.

    From the Safari menu bar, select
    Safari ▹ Preferences ▹ Extensions
    Turn all extensions OFF and test. If the problem is resolved, turn extensions back ON and then disable them one or a few at a time until you find the culprit.
    If you wish, you may be able to salvage the malfunctioning extension by uninstalling and reinstalling it. That will revert its settings to the defaults.

  • Reminders alerts disappear from lock screen

    Hi, I'm facing problem with reminders alerts on lockscreen (iPhone 5, ios 8.1.2) Alert stays approx. 15 minutes on the lock screen and suddenly disappears. This happens only for Reminders, other alerts such a missed calls or messages are fine. It drive me crazy. For example when I leave phone and come back in one hour, I can't see missed reminders alerts, because they  already disappeared. I tried disconnect from iCloud (synchronized reminders with Mac book air), reset iPhone settings, completely reset iPhone and install from scratch. But this problem remains. Do you have any suggestions? Thank you very much!!!

    Meanwhile I found that mentioned problem occurs only when I fetch emails or calendar via gmail account etc... So after email or calendar  synchronization is fetched on the background (each 15 mnts in my case), reminder alert disappear from then lock screen. If I set manual fetch, reminders lock screen alerts persist fine. I checked out the same behavior on my wife's iPhone, so I assume it is iOS 8.1.2 bug. Does anybody have such  issue?
